A Program in Miracles (ACIM) stands as a profound and major spiritual teaching that appeared in the latter half the 20th century. Their roots could be traced back again to the cooperation between Helen Schucman, a psychologist, and Bill Thetford, her friend, equally of whom were connected with the Office of Psychiatry at Columbia University's School of Physicians and Surgeons in New York City. The class itself was channeled through Schucman's inner voice, which she determined as Jesus Christ. First published in 1976, ACIM has since gained a separate following and has become a seminal work in the world of spiritual literature.

The key tenet of A Course in Miracles is the variance involving the pride and the real Self. The confidence, in accordance with ACIM, is the fake self that arises from a opinion in divorce from God and others. It's the origin of anxiety, judgment, and conflict. The actual Self, on one other hand, may be the divine essence within every individual, representing love, peace, and unity. ACIM asserts that the journey toward self-realization and religious awareness involves the dismantling of the ego and the acceptance of one's correct identity as a religious being.

Forgiveness holds a vital position in the teachings of ACIM. Unlike conventional notions of forgiveness, which regularly include pardoning the perceived wrongdoings of the others, ACIM's forgiveness is a procedure of issuing judgments and grievances used against oneself and others. It is just a acceptance that the observed sins and errors are seated in the illusions of the ego, and through forgiveness, you can see beyond these illusions to the inherent purity and divinity atlanta divorce attorneys being. ACIM teaches that forgiveness is just a road to internal peace and the main element to undoing the ego's hang on the mind.
